在 BizTalk Server 中配置 XML 汇编程序管道组件
XML 汇编程序管道组件用于在从 BizTalk Server 发送消息之前将 XML 文档包装到 XML 信封中。
配置 XML 汇编程序管道组件的属性
将 XML 组装器管道组件拖入发送管道的组装阶段中。
在属性窗口的“管道组件属性”部分中,执行以下操作。
添加处理说明:选项:
追加 (默认) : 添加处理指令文本 应追加到消息中预先存在的处理指令的值。
新建: 在 字段中输入的 “添加处理指令”文本 的值应覆盖或替换消息中预先存在的任何处理指令。
如果选择了 “新建” ,则 “添加处理指令”文本 必须包含有效的处理指令。
忽略:如果消息中存在处理指令文本,则会将其删除。
添加处理指令文本:指定要添加到目标 XML 文档开头的 XML 处理指令。 默认值: None
处理指令文本应符合 W3C XML 处理指令标准。
添加 XML 声明:当 True (默认) 时,将类似于以下内容的 XML 声明添加到传出文档:
<?xml version='1.0' encoding='UTF-8'>
。 编码由在运行时设置的目标文档编码确定。文档架构:指示要应用于文档的架构的命名空间和类型名称。 默认值: 空集合
有关详细信息,请参阅 如何使用架构集合属性编辑器。
如果为 Document 架构属性输入两个或更多个架构,则可能会收到两个或更多所选架构共享同一目标命名空间错误。
信封架构:指示将应用于信封的架构的命名空间和 typename。 默认值: 空集合
有关详细信息,请参阅 如何使用架构集合属性编辑器。
如果为 Envelope 架构属性输入两个或多个架构,则可能会收到两个或多个所选架构共享同一目标命名空间错误。
保留字节顺序标记:指定是否 (BOM) 向汇编程序组件生成的文档添加字节顺序标记。 默认值:True
处理指令范围:指定是在最外层的信封上还是在文档级别定义处理指令。 默认值: 文档
目标字符集:指定用于对传出消息进行编码的字符集。 默认值: None
另请参阅
XML 汇编程序管道组件
配置本地管道组件
XML 和平面文件属性架构和属性
Pipelines-AssemblerDisassembler(BizTalk Server 示例文件夹)